For technology enthusiasts and gamers, keeping an eye on deal drops for graphics cards and CPUs can save you a significant amount of money. Timing your purchases around specific sales periods and events can maximize savings and ensure you get the best value for your money.
Annual Sales Events
Many of the best deals on computer hardware occur during annual sales events. These include Black Friday, Cyber Monday, and back-to-school sales. During these periods, retailers and online marketplaces offer steep discounts on popular components.
Black Friday and Cyber Monday
Black Friday, which falls on the day after Thanksgiving in the United States, is renowned for massive discounts across electronics, including graphics cards and CPUs. Cyber Monday, the following Monday, also features significant online-only deals. Both events are prime times to purchase high-end hardware at reduced prices.
Back-to-School Season
In late summer, around August and September, many retailers promote back-to-school sales. These often include discounts on technology products, making it an excellent time for students and educators to upgrade their systems.
Post-Release Price Adjustments
When new generations of graphics cards or CPUs are announced, older models typically see price reductions. Monitoring product announcements from manufacturers like NVIDIA, AMD, and Intel can help you buy previous-generation hardware at lower prices shortly after new releases.
Seasonal Trends and Holiday Sales
Throughout the year, seasonal trends influence hardware pricing. Holiday seasons such as Christmas and New Year often bring special promotions. Additionally, mid-year sales in June or July can also feature significant discounts, especially during summer clearance events.
Monitoring and Timing Tips
- Sign up for newsletters from major retailers and hardware manufacturers to stay informed about upcoming sales.
- Use price tracking tools and websites to monitor fluctuations in component prices.
- Plan your purchase around the release cycles of new products to take advantage of discounts on older models.
- Be patient and wait for major sales events to maximize savings.
